
Reliance Steel & Aluminum Co. (RS) operates as a premier diversified metal solutions provider and a leading metal service center, serving clients across the United States, Canada, and globally. The company provides an extensive inventory of approximately 100,000 metal products, including alloys, aluminum, brass, copper, carbon steel, stainless steel, titanium, and various specialty steels. Reliance NYSE: RS reported what executives described as another strong quarter, with record tons sold, sharply higher year-over-year sales and stronger profitability supported by favorable pricing, improving demand across several end markets and initial contributions from a U.S. Department of Homeland Security border wall contract.
